미국 고령친화주거지 사례조사를 통한 여가문화시설 계획 특성에 관한 연구
박소임(Park, So-Im) 대한건축학회 2016 대한건축학회 학술발표대회 논문집 Vol.36 No.2
Facing the reality that, due to a rapid increase in the senior citizen population in Korea, within 10 years Korea will enter a super high aged society with more than 10 million senior citizens, current research focuses on local scoped research on a micro scale including research on facilities for senior citizens and the development of residential facilities, rather than on related restoration and planning at the environmental level for senior citizens. To prepare for the continued aging of the senior population and Baby boomer generation, there is an imminent need to prepare an active countermeasure through a comprehensive solution that takes into consideration the activities and residential and living space areas of senior citizens, rather than to continue research in the direction of the previously local approach. Current society and culture accommodates the urban inflow of senior citizens such as retirees, and self-sustaining economic virtuous cycles provide cities with sustainable models. In this research study, based on the analysis of case studies on the forms of leisure and cultural activities of retirees in the United States and on the physical characteristics of the residential environments of senior citizens selected from domestic and overseas case studies, the leisure culture planning characteristics of senior citizen living spaces in the United States were examined and derived.
고령자의 정주 실현을 위한 건강복지환경 구축방안 연구 : 블루존(Blue zone) 개념을 중심으로
박소임(So-Im Park),장수정(Soo-Jung Chang) 한국비교정부학회 2021 한국비교정부학보 Vol.25 No.3
(Purpose) With the global aging of population, discussion to realize the Aging In Place, which allows elderly to spend old age in their current residence in healthy status by supporting the independent living of them are ongoing at the city, region, and village level. The purpose of this study was to propose a strategy to establish a health/welfare environments that realize a healthy settlement for the elderly by applying the concept of Blue zone where the health of the community are improved through close connection between individuals and communities and improvement of the physical environment and the cooperation of social organizations. (Design/methodology/approach) This study attempted to derive implications for establishing a health/welfare environment for the realization of a settlement for the elderly from the case studies of Korean projects to establish healthy environment based on the common purpose of promoting citizens health. As a part of the strategy to differentiate with previous similar projects, this study performed a case analysis with the principle of creating Blue zone, one of the advanced cases of global healthy village. (Findings) For the building of community where the elderly settle with no difficulties, the utilization of the existing infrastructure to ensure continuity rather than short-term project and linking through institutional support are needed. (Research implications or Originality) This study derived physical and social factors affecting healthy settlement and proposed a step-by-step strategy to realize a health/welfare environments for the elderly. A healthy settlement of elderly may be realized when a gradual and chain changes should be induced from a mid-long term perspective in the future related research and projects.

종합사회복지관 이용 고령자의 치매예방 기능성 게임 수용 영향요인 분석
박소임(So Im Park),장수정(Soo Jung Chang) 한국디지털콘텐츠학회 2023 한국디지털콘텐츠학회논문지 Vol.24 No.7
This study investigated the factors influencing the adoption of dementia prevention serious games among elderly individuals. A survey was conducted with 100 elderly participants from elderly welfare centers in Seoul, South Korea. The study aimed to identify and analyze the key technological acceptance factors, such as Playfulness, Prevention & usefulness of cognitive decline, Satisfaction level of use, and Expectations for demand. The analysis revealed a positive association between higher levels of Playfulness, Prevention & usefulness of cognitive decline, and Satisfaction level of use, with increased Expectations for demand. Among these factors, Prevention & usefulness of cognitive decline exhibited the strongest influence, whereas demographic variables did not show any significant impact. The findings suggest that effectively managing elements related to enjoyment, usability, satisfaction, and effectiveness is crucial to foster positive perceptions and attitudes toward serious games among the elderly. Moreover, the study demonstrates that dementia prevention serious games can generate substantial demand expectations, irrespective of elderly individuals’ personal and environmental characteristics.
